Bollywood actress Kangana Ranaut has always been vocal of her opinions and take stands for unjust. The actress known for her bold statements has been under the social media radar for her opinions related to the unfortunate demise of Sushant Singh Rajput. However, she had refrained herself from directly addressing her fans over the social media networks for years until now.

While Kangana Ranaut managed to put across her opinions through her team handle and her sister, Rangoli Ranaut, who herself is known for being outspoken, the actress has finally joined the micro-blogging website, Twitter. Taking to the social network, Kangana announced her entry with a video addressing her fans and the need to put an end to her social absence. In the shared video, Kangana started with mentioning that she has been in the industry for over one and a half-decade but never joined social media despite immense pressure from ad agencies and brands.

The actress says that people took advantage of her absence on the social media platforms and even called her a witch with twisted legs. The actress further stated that she has learnt that social media has the power to stand against unjust and social issues and she wishes to harness this power for the greater good. She is hopeful that her strong social media presence would come in handy in raising the voice when it comes to New India reforms.

Kangana is currently pro-actively taking part in the ongoing nepotism debate post the alleged suicide of Bollywood actor Sushant Singh Rajput. The actress firmly claims that the ‘nepotism gangs’ in the Bollywood industry had a hand in the unfortunate incident.
